Chilean Unit Of Account (Uf)
The Chilean Unit of Account (UF) is a financial unit used in Chile, primarily for indexing and legal purposes, representing a fixed value that adjusts according to inflation.
History/Origin
Introduced in 1967, the UF was established to serve as a stable reference for contracts and legal transactions, adjusting periodically based on inflation indices to preserve its value over time.
Current Use
The UF is widely used in Chile for valuing real estate, loans, and legal contracts, and it is updated daily based on the Chilean Consumer Price Index (CPI).
Bosnia-Herzegovina Convertible Mark
The Bosnia-Herzegovina Convertible Mark (BAM) is the official currency of Bosnia and Herzegovina, used for everyday transactions and financial exchanges within the country.
History/Origin
Introduced in 1998, the BAM replaced the Bosnia and Herzegovina dinar following the country's monetary reform and stabilization efforts after the Bosnian War. It is pegged to the Euro at a fixed rate, ensuring stability.
Current Use
The BAM is widely used throughout Bosnia and Herzegovina for all forms of payment, including cash, banking, and electronic transactions. It remains the country's official currency and is managed by the Central Bank of Bosnia and Herzegovina.
